Output 7efdc6f28e7632d2d4bc3ad79659b9df476b0b914e265ce9b70f9421a858feca:0

value
12749292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f613b43c7ba9a7a509bda6867c6b1579506ff29b OP_EQUAL
address
3Q89ko5bYv8AYF5UG3n6eAFQz8Kf1zjNhk
transaction
7efdc6f28e7632d2d4bc3ad79659b9df476b0b914e265ce9b70f9421a858feca
spent
true